The 16th General Assembly of Nova Scotia represented Nova Scotia between 1836 and 1840. The assembly was dissolved in October 21 1840.

The assembly sat at the pleasure of the Governor of Nova Scotia, Colin Campbell.

Samuel George William Archibald was chosen as speaker for the house.
